and 20 minutes later arrived at Sun Studios



The parking behind Sun Studios is not very spacious but we managed to squeeze in and just prayed no one clipped the car trying to get past !

We hadn’t realised the tours were at specific times so we did hang about for 15 minutes or so waiting for the next one .

Our tour guide though was excellent – a real enthusiast and incredibly informative. He made it a thoroughly absorbing experience .

The tour starts upstairs and centres on Sam Phillips and his studios, how he initially passed up on the chance to hear Elvis and how his receptionist/secretary saved the day and what was happening in the music industry at the time



And then you head downstairs to the reception and into the recording studio







It was fab to be standing in that studio and we listened to music and radio recordings and learned more about both Elvis and others like Johnny Cash and Jerry Lee Lewis and that famous pic of the million dollar quartet.

It was fascinating - especially the part about drums not being ok on country music until the 1970s and how Johnny Cash allegedly got round that ...

And then you get to pose with the mic that all those artists use ( do hope they antibac wipe it now and again )

After a couple of hours we headed out to Main Street for dinner at Flight Wine Bar – proving it’s a small world we bumped into the lawyer we met yesterday as we were walking along the street !



This was packed when we arrived , thank goodness we had made a reservation. We sat upstairs.

Unfortunately we were right under an aircon unit and Andy was so cold he was using the tablecloth to cover his arms! Happily they turned it down when we mentioned it.





This was a hard place to take pics, super dark and every time I got the camera out, I got the deadeye from the table next to us .

So I darent use the flash.

The majority of people seemed super posh in there !

I had been a bit concerned that they wouldn’t allow Andy in his shorts , especially as you can just see some of his latest tattoo at the edges … but they were fine

Said tattoo…



Anyhow, given the stink eye from the tables nearby, I had to be secret squirrel taking the pics


So menu ones are crummy sorry
.

The concept here is that you can have the recommended flight for the price on the left, or mix any three small plates taking the first price on the right per dish , or any single dish as a main for the second price on the right. Brilliant way to mix and match .





I went for the steak flight, Andy had the Chefs special flight



It was all delicious. I think the Bison ribeye was my favourite but the Elk was good too. I would never have tried these unless they were taster portions. The truffle mac’n’cheese was gorgeous too.

It was all very flavourful and perfect portion sizes.

We didn't go for the wine flights, just opting for a single glass each

Then on to dessert ... Only available as set flights



I had the traditional flight and Andy had the whisky flight





I started with the strudel as it was the only warm dish but my goodness it was filling. I could barely manage any of the cheesecake by the time I had got through the other two …

$139 bill but well worth it.



What a great concept. Excellent service, fabulous quality food, attention to detail and generally a 5* experience. We waddled back to the hotel feeling very full !
